5 really quick tips for handling stress better
1. Take care of your stress positively. It’s easy to react to problems by having a glass or two at the end of the day or smoking more, but in the long term this doesn’t help your body cope with stress and can contribute to a worsening of your health over time.
2. Learn to breathe properly. By taking deep breaths your mind clears and your body is forced to physically relax.
3. Relax regularly. Nothing is more important in your diary than the time you take to positively relax so build in time for some feel-good activity you love and know will help you switch off – music, dancing, playing with your dog/kids – anything you enjoy which will let your mind focus on other things rather than your problems.
4. Find someone to talk to. Don’t waste your energy by keep feelings bottled up and your mind whirring endlessly about your problem without result. That will just wear you out and not gain you anything. Someone you trust may offer some insight you hadn’t thought of, may have been through a similar experience, or may know where you can go to find support and advice to solve the situation.
5. Remember - you are never alone in any situation, no matter how bad. Someone else has been there before and survived. Everything passes. No matter how hard life may seem at the moment, in 6 months things can be very different and so much better. Always have hope.
